Mayor visits injured scholars
Injured school children get a visit from the mayor.
The executive mayor of Ekurhuleni, Mondli Gungubele, visited Natalspruit Hospital, in Boksburg, on Tuesday, to wish a speedy recovery to scholars who were injured in a collision, while travelling in a school transport vehicle, on Heidelberg Road, on Monday morning.
Tshepo Moloi (18), who sustained a femur fracture, and Ntokozo Mabuya (12), who suffered a mandibular fracture, are among the five pupils who were critically injured when the two vehicles collided.
Twelve people — 11 children and the driver of the Toyota Condor — were injured when the Toyota collided with a truck.
The mayor wished the pupils a speedy recovery and encouraged them to focus on getting well, in order to return to school.
“Based on the brief I received from the doctors you will be back to school in no time,” he said.
“You must thank God that you have survived this fatal accident, because it is only through him that you are alive.”
